AI: Fueling Efficiency and Redefining Growth
Consider Grant Lee, a seasoned Silicon Valley entrepreneur. He's constantly courted by investors eager to pour capital into his AI start-up, Gamma, founded in 2020. Some even resort to personalized gift baskets. While such attention would typically be welcomed, Gamma is charting a different course. By integrating AI tools across its operations – from customer service and marketing to coding and research – Gamma has achieved remarkable efficiency. With a mere 28 employees, the company boasts tens of millions in annual recurring revenue and serves nearly 50 million users, all while maintaining profitability. This lean structure stands in stark contrast to the traditional 200-employee benchmark for a company of Gamma's size, demonstrating the transformative potential of AI.

The "Tiny Team" Phenomenon: A Testament to AI's Power
Anecdotes of "tiny team" successes have become a cultural touchstone in the tech world. Stories of Anysphere, the creator of coding software Cursor, reaching $100 million in annual recurring revenue with just 20 employees in under two years, or ElevenLabs, an AI voice start-up, achieving the same feat with around 50 employees, are now commonplace. These narratives highlight the disruptive power of AI, enabling small, agile teams to compete with established players. Setting New Limits: Embracing AI-Driven Efficiency
Emboldened by AI's capabilities, some start-ups are proactively setting limits on their workforce size. Runway Financial, a finance software company, plans to cap its headcount at 100, confident that AI will empower each employee to achieve the output of 1.5 traditional workers. Similarly, Agency, an AI-powered customer service start-up, aims to maintain a workforce of no more than 100. This strategic decision reflects a focus on maximizing efficiency and leveraging AI to eliminate redundant roles.

The Venture Capital Dilemma: Adapting to the New Landscape
This new paradigm presents a challenge for traditional venture capital firms. While AI companies attracted significant investment in 2023, raising $97 billion and representing 46% of all US venture investment (according to PitchBook), the reduced funding needs of AI-powered start-ups create a dilemma for investors accustomed to deploying large sums of capital. If winning companies require less funding due to smaller teams, how does this impact the traditional venture capital model? This question underscores the need for adaptation within the investment community.
The Funding Paradox: Navigating Investor Enthusiasm
Despite this challenge, investor enthusiasm for AI remains high. Scribe, an AI productivity start-up, experienced this firsthand. While seeking to raise $25 million, they were overwhelmed by investor interest, ultimately negotiating the smallest possible investment amount. Investors expressed surprise at Scribe's 100-person team, given its three million users and rapid growth. This anecdote highlights the disconnect between traditional investor expectations and the realities of AI-driven efficiency.

The Pitfalls of Hypergrowth: Lessons from the Past
The shift towards leaner start-ups also reflects a growing awareness of the pitfalls of the traditional hypergrowth model. Many companies from the 2021 funding boom ultimately downsized, shut down, or sold themselves, highlighting the risks of aggressive scaling and unsustainable burn rates. The constant pressure to raise capital and expand teams often led to escalating costs, complex management structures, and a dependence on perpetual fundraising. These experiences have prompted a reassessment of the traditional start-up playbook.

From Fundraising to Customer Focus: A Shift in Priorities
This newfound freedom from the constant pressure of fundraising allows founders like Gamma's Grant Lee to focus on what truly matters: the customer. Lee actively engages with Gamma's users, gathering feedback and incorporating it into product development. He even established a dedicated Slack channel for direct interaction with top users, often surprising them with his personal involvement. This customer-centric approach fosters loyalty and provides invaluable insights for product improvement. It represents a shift away from the investor-focused mindset of the past towards a more sustainable, customer-driven approach.
Rethinking Talent: The Rise of the Generalist
Lee’s approach to talent acquisition also reflects this shift. While planning to expand Gamma’s workforce, he prioritizes generalists over specialists, seeking individuals capable of handling a range of tasks. He also favors "player-coaches," individuals who can both contribute directly to the work and mentor junior employees, over traditional managers. This preference for versatility and mentorship reflects a move towards flatter organizational structures and a more collaborative work environment.
